A Brief History of Slot Games

The first slot machine, invented by Charles Fey in 1887, was called the Liberty Bell. It featured three reels and a single payline, with symbols such as hearts, diamonds, and spades. The game’s popularity grew rapidly, and by the early 20th century, slot machines were being used in casinos across the United States.

The introduction of electromechanical devices in the 1960s marked the beginning of a new era for slot games. These machines offered more features, including multiple paylines and progressive jackpots. The rise of microprocessors in the 1980s enabled developers to create even more complex games with advanced graphics and sound effects.

The modern era of slot games began in the late 1990s, with the introduction of online slots. Developers such as Microgaming and Playtech pioneered the market, creating games that could be played on desktop computers and eventually mobile devices. Today, there are thousands of different slot games available online, ranging from classic three-reelers to elaborate video slots.

The Science Behind Slot Games

Slot machines are designed using a combination of mathematics, psychology, and game theory. The Random Number Generator (RNG) is the core component of any modern slot machine, responsible for generating random numbers that determine the outcome of each spin.

Game developers use algorithms to create games with varying levels of volatility, which refers to the frequency and size of payouts. Some slots are designed to pay out frequently but with smaller amounts, while others offer larger wins less often. This balance is crucial in keeping players engaged and entertained.

The concept of return to player (RTP) is also essential in slot game design. RTP refers to the percentage of total bets that a game returns to players over time. A higher RTP indicates that a game is more generous, but it can also lead to lower profits for casinos.
